Cilantro Lime Rice

By Jamie Sherman
Easily transform plain rice into this lively Cilantro Lime Rice dish. It makes the perfect accompaniment to a Mexican dinner!
Prep: 15 minutes
Cook: 30 minutes
Total: 45 minutes

Ingredients 

  • 2 cups chicken broth or water
  • 1 cup long-grain white rice
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ice, more to taste
  • ¼ cup chopped cilantro, more to taste
  • 1 teaspoon lime zest, optional

Instructions 

  • In a medium saucepan, bring the chicken broth and rice to a boil. Cover, reduce heat to low, and simmer until the rice is tender, about 20 minutes.
  • Remove the rice from the heat and fluff with a fork. Stir the lime juice, cilantro and lime zest into the cooked rice just before serving.

Notes

  • This is great as a side dish or used inside burritos or burrito bowls.
